Mips Biography

Mips is a leader in helmet safety technology focusing on rotational energies and cooperates with 121 helmet brands that offer more than 729 models equipped with the Mips® system on the global helmet market. The Mips® system consists of a low friction layer that is mounted in the helmet. In a crash, the low friction layer is designed to move slightly inside the helmet in order to help redirect forces away from the head. This is intended to help reduce the risk of brain injury.

Motul Biography

Motul can trace its roots back to 1853 when the specialist lubrication company Swan & Finch was founded. Motul was originally the name of their flagship oil, but became the corporate name in 1965. With a long-standing and highly successful motorsport relationship with HRC and Honda, the brand continues to supply the oils and grease to the factory MXGP team in 2019.

Pirelli Biography

Founded in Milan in 1872 by Giovanni Battista Pirelli, the company initially specialised in rubber and derivative processes and also made scuba diving rebreathers. Pirelli is now one of the largest tyre manufacturers and has been sponsoring sport competitions since 1907.

PT Astra Honda Motor Biography

Since it was built in 1971, PT Astra Honda Motor (AHM) has become the biggest motorcycle industry in Indonesia. As a joint venture company of PT Astra International Tbk and Honda Motor Co., Ltd. with the share composition of 50% : 50%, AHM has made impressive growth with four established plants with total production capacity of 5.8 million motorcycle units per year, making it one of the biggest motorcycle manufacturers in the world.
With “One HEART” or “Satu HATI”, AHM has accompanied millions of Indonesian customers in reaching their dreams by providing high quality and environmentally friendly motorcycle products. In 2022, AHM kept its position as the market leader in Indonesia through its sales which reached 3.9 million units.
AHM is supported by around 24 thousand employees, 29 Honda main dealers, 1,708 Honda dealers (Include 11 Big Wing and 144 Wing dealers), 3,717 Astra Honda Authorized Service Stations (AHASS) and 8,447 spare parts stores throughout Indonesia.

Hitachi Astemo, Ltd. Biography

Hitachi Astemo was born in January 2021 from the merger of Hitachi Automotive Systems, Keihin, Showa, and Nissin Kogyo. We provide Advanced Sustainable Technologies for Mobility to the automotive and motorcycle industries as a leader in CASE technologies that include connectivity, autonomous driving, and electrification.
As a leading brand of suspension products that support driving, turning, and stopping, SHOWA is committed to research and development in pursuit of excellent ride comfort and handling stability.
We are determined to maintain our top share in the global market by providing safe, enjoyable, and environmentally friendly products with our strong brand and advanced technologies cultivated through the world’s most prestigious races.
